I followed the excellent guide in the tutorial for adding textures... It worked, but can someone describe for me the proper format for textures that fill one cube like the ones that come with pas?

I checked and it seems the ones I checked (which fit to one cube in the editor) are 512x512

Tried saving mine to that but it does not seem to work. I mean the texture loads but it takes many squares to display it in full, otherwise it only displays a portion of it in one cube...

After some trial and error I got it....

Its 64x64 to make a texture fill one square, way off the 512x512 I was trying... DOH!

haywiresystem wrote: I checked and it seems the ones I checked (which fit to one cube in the editor) are 512x512

Tried saving mine to that but it does not seem to work. I mean the texture loads but it takes many squares to display it in full, otherwise it only displays a portion of it in one cube...
You could just use /vscale ## to change the size (so 2 = twice as large while .25 = 1/4 as large)
haywiresystem wrote:Can you NOT add new textures to an existing map at all? Gives invalid texture when I tried to add textures.... Works with new map...?
Not sure what you mean, it is pretty easy to add textures to a new map, just open up (mapname)-art.cfg and add the proper texture codes to the bottom. Additionally, you could use /exec packages/.../packages.cfg to execute the commands within the file, which may include texture loading commands.

Thank you, I copied the info from my packages.cfg file into the untitled-art file (the file for the map I've been working on) And it worked. At first, my whole world was screwed up because I didn't put that at the end of the textures list... Once I put it at the end and restarted, everything worked perfectly... Thanks for your help!
